Ticking Exhaust

After installing my RS*R a few weeks ago I notice my exhaust ticks. Not a few sperratic times when the car is cooling but near constantly. About every 2-4 seconds "tick". I looked under the car to see where the sound comes from and I am pretty sure its the resonator after the cat. Is there anything I can do to stop or reduce the ticking.
